Super Sleeper 1.0.3
Super Sleeper offers you a free application allowing you to quickly change the type of sleep that your Intel based Mac performs when it goes to sleep. more>>
Super Sleeper 1.0.3 offers you a free application allowing you to quickly change the type of sleep that your Intel based Mac performs when it goes to sleep.
By default OS X will not only sleep to RAM but also writes out a hibernate file just in case power all of the time, the use of a hibernate file is overkill.
If you are willing to sacrifice the safety net of hibernate, then using RAM based sleep is much faster when putting your notebook to sleep. On a MacBook Pro the difference is time is 10-30 seconds versus 2-3.

SleepTight 1.0.1
Lock your Mac when it goes to sleep. more>>
Since the screensaver is the only Apple-supplied method of locking your machine without logging out, this means that a machine which has been put to sleep may wake up unlocked if the screensaver did not start on its own before the sleep timeout. This is especially frustrating for PowerBook users, who typically put their machines to sleep by closing the lid. Since the lid closure doesnt start the screensaver, the PowerBook will awaken unlocked.
Apple will be fixing this in the next version of MacOS X (10.3 Panther, see the new features). In the meantime Jaguar users can use SleepTight.

SleepWatcher is an effective utility which monitors sleep, wakeup and idleness of a Mac. more>>
SleepWatcher 2.0.5 is an effective utility which monitors sleep, wakeup and idleness of a Mac.
It can be used to execute a Unix command when the Mac or the display of the Mac goes to sleep mode or wakes up or after a given time without user interaction. It also can send the Mac to sleep mode or retrieve the time since last user activity.
A StartupItem, sample start and sleep scripts and the source code for sleepwatcher are included in the download. A little bit knowledge of the Unix command line is required to benefit from this software.
